Role & Responsibilities
- Coordinate general facilities activities and maintenance for the entire physical plant
- Supervise renovations, remodels, and in-store workers contracted from external vendors
- Maintain lighting and ballast supplies, including bulb replacement and fixture repairs
- Supervise housekeeping staff to ensure adherence to store standards and presentation
- Conduct facilities audits and inspections using standardized checklists
- Perform store opening duties including activation of lighting, HVAC systems, escalators, and security
- Execute POS and scanner repairs, including printer, monitor, and related equipment maintenance
- Perform touch-up painting, spot repairs to fixtures, carpet, flooring, hinges, and locks
- Support floor moves and fixture/cash wrap repositioning
- Respond to store emergency calls and facility-related incidents
- Monitor trash hauling and compactor operations
- Maintain and track work orders, elevator repairs, and purchase orders with proper authorization
- Approve and maintain records of contract labor for HVAC, vertical transportation, gate systems, and glass services
- Coordinate telephone and PC/CRT repairs across the store
- Communicate with property management, coordinate deliveries, and ensure certificates of insurance are current
